Got FS earlier today via Xbox Game Pass, which as the first time I signed up to it, was discounted 75% too.

 

This forced me to tidy up my SSDs to make up the required 150GB free before it would install. After uninstall some Steam games I don't play (and might never play) I was good, but I noticed also there were many orphaned installs in the steam folder. This took up many tens of GB, so might be something to check up on if you have a particularly old game library.

 

Anyway, load times were a bit slow, I thought I was on a console! At this point, my gaming PC specs are:

1080Ti

8086k (turbo disabled from previous testing, never turned it back on)

64GB 3200 ram (4x16GB)

OS: Optane 280GB

FS: Crucial BX200 1TB

Monitor is Acer Predator 1440p 144Hz G-sync

 

After the main download, I started the game. The initial config screen bugged a bit, but pressing some buttons got it to display after all. It offered my system the Ultra preset so I went with it. Turned on all the assists. Poking through the settings menus, I turned up the rolling cache and manual cache. I had no context for what size to set them, and might have gone overboard with 32GB and 64GB respectively. Adding a part of Swindon around my house to the manual cache took less than 1GB.

 

I wanted just to do a quick flight and see if I can see my house. The search function seemed broken, or I don't know how to use it. I couldn't get any results for airports by name or code. In the end I had to pick them manually on the map. I chose Lyneham to Fairford as I knew my house is in between. In the plane, it told me to use ctrl-numpad-decimal to turn off the parking brake. I'm using TKL... so I grabbed a full size keyboard off another system and plugged it in, at which point the game crashed.

 

I thought at this point I'd dust off my Warthog HOTAS and get serious. Starting the game again, I went into the control settings. It looked like the main stick was ok, as you can press buttons and it'll show activity when detected. The buttons on the throttle side weren't all working though, but I just ignored it and moved on. Something to sort out later.

 

Soon I was back in the cockpit. However I was in a different plane than last time. Never mind, I'll work around it. Parking brake released, throttle up, and I'm moving. I couldn't find the airspeed, not that I knew what takeoff speed was for the craft, so I just bought the nose up when the game prompted and I was away! A large part of the problems from this point is due to me not knowing the aircraft, or controls. Game told me to bring the gerar up. I pressed the mapped button, nothing seemed to happen. Then I remembered it might be one of the throttle side ones that wasn't working in the earlier check. Never mind. Game kept telling me throughout the flight to climb to some altitude, but not what that altitude was. Didn't see anything in the ATC log either. It also kept warning me about my speed should be reduced below 95kts. I now wonder if that's because I didn't retract the gear. I'm not sure I could get the plane that slow regardless.

 

I couldn't monitor fps, because nvidia's drivers was being silly and overlaid the recording icons over the fps count. The fps was visible on the recording, so after the fact I saw most of the time it was running around low-20's fps. Reminder: this is as 2560x1440 Ultra on a 1080Ti. This is about half the fps that Tom's Hardware reported for that configuration (I only remember as the last article I saw). I'm wondering if Vsync is working against me here, not sure if the game is running full screen or borderless Windowed. When the game was loading assets, it dropped to single digit fps.

 

Flight controls were doing weird things. I wonder if it is because I had all assists on, and I wasn't sticking to the flight plan (not that I knew what it was) in the search for my house. Landing went about as well as can be expected for someone who doesn't know the controls. My first contact with the ground wasn't too bad, but I had excess speed and was airborne again not long after. Being more aggressive with pushing the nose down I made it stay down after another bounce or two. Damage is turned off. I also used the brake button that appeared on screen and it didn't take long to stop. Taxiing to parking spot was really weird. Brake off, at low throttle nothing was happening so I had to push a bit more, but that made me speed even after reducing back to minimum. Had to frequently brake to keep speed down. Also, the steering went everywhere. Again, I wonder if this is related to having assists on, and I might not have passed all expected waypoints. Once I got to the parking spot (I wouldn't want to be the guy with the wavy things to tell you when to stop!), only then did it ask me to request taxi. Bit late? That did let me complete the flight, kinda. It gave me a key combo to shut down engine, but when I did that it complained my engine was off and told me to start it again. Whatever, I'm done.

 

And just to finish off a perfect experience, I tried to exit game. It stuck on the exit screen. After leaving it some time to see if it would sort itself out, I had to force close it from task manager.

I haven't had as many issues.

 

The game crashes occasionally and more frequently it will freeze and need a minute. Luckily, whenever it froze for me it didn't have the simulation continue in the background so that unbeknownst to me I am crashing into the ground. 

 

My experience has been to be a bit more patient with it and not overload it with inputs at the same time. 

 

My setup:

I use a keyboard along with an Xbox controller. Settings on High with a few tweaks to make textures look sharper. I have a 2070S with a R5-2600X. I don't mind 30 fps on this game since it is not an action game.

 

Tip: there is a new Nvidia driver which supposedly is optimized for MSFS.
